The MAX4312ESE+ is a high-speed, low-power video multiplexer amplifier housed in a 16-pin NSOIC package. It features eight channels with an integrated adjustable gain amplifier optimized for stability at unity gain. The device offers fast channel switching with a typical time of 40ns and minimal switching transients of 10mVp-p, making it ideal for video switching applications. It boasts a bandwidth of 265MHz, a slew rate of up to 460V/µs, and is suitable for driving back-terminated cables. Operating over a voltage range from ±2V to ±5.25V or 4V to 10.5V and with an operating temperature range from -40°C to 85°C, this amplifier maintains a gain of at least +1. Rail-to-rail output drives 150 ohm loads within 730mV of the supply rails, with input common mode voltage including negative rails. It provides differential gain and phase errors of 0.06% and 0.08°, respectively, and consumes as little as 7.4mA in full operation. A low power shutdown mode reduces current to 560µA and places outputs in a high impedance state.
